3、HOTO COURTESY OF COPPELL(TEXAS)COMMUNITY EXPERIENCES2|2025 National Recreation and Park AssociationEXECUTIVE SUMMARYLocal park and recreation agencies and the profes-sionals who work in this field create environments in which the community members they serve can thrive.These unique entities shape ne
4、ighborhoods,provide opportunities for health and well-being,serve as environ-mental havens and offer locales in which communities of all sizes can gather.Recognizing the wants and needs of the residents they serve,park and recreation professionals are keenly aware of the necessary balance between pr
5、oviding vital services and working within the confines of bud-getary restrictions.Maintaining accurate knowledge of current assets and planning for future needs are critical for every park and recreation agency.To assist individual agencies in evaluating their programs and making critical decisions
6、that will benefit their communities,NRPA collects annual nationwide data on characteristics of agencies,including types of programs offered,size of population served,budget and staffing.This report contains summaries of these data.About the ReviewPark and recreation agencies nationwide used the NRPA
